Design and analysis of an under-constrained reconfigurable cable-driven parallel robot

In this paper, we first design a new reconfigurable cable-driven parallel robot, whose cable drawing points can be relocated by extra cables. Compared to most existing cable-driven robots whose cable drawing points are assumed to be fixed, the designed robot can operate in a very large workspace eliminating the possible collision between cables and surrounding environment. Then some interesting and challenging tasks for the robot are outlined, indicating that the designed mechanism may find some potential applications in practice. After that, the kinematics, dynamics, and workspace of the mechanism are analyzed, and dynamically feasible trajectories are designed analytically taking advantage of the unilateral cable tension constraints. Finally, a numerical simulation is carried out to show the effectiveness of the dynamic trajectory planning technique.
